XBee/XBeePRO"燨EM燫F燤odules??02.15.4?爒1.xAx燵2007.05.031]
2007燤axStream,營(yíng)nc.
牋牋?9
Chapter??燫F燤odule燙onfiguration
*燜irmware爒ersion爄n爓hich爐he燾ommand爓as爁irst爄ntroduced?firmware爒ersions燼re爊umbered爄n爃exadecimal爊otation.)
RF Interfacing
*燜irmware爒ersion爄n爓hich爐he燾ommand爓as爁irst爄ntroduced?firmware爒ersions燼re爊umbered爄n爃exadecimal爊otation.)
AS ( v1.x80*)
Networking
{Association}
Active Scan. Send Beacon Request to Broadcast Address (0xFFFF) and Broadcast
PAN (0xFFFF) on every channel. The parameter determines the time the radio will
listen for Beacons on each channel. A PanDescriptor is created and returned for every
Beacon received from the scan. Each PanDescriptor contains the following information:
CoordAddress (SH, SL)
CoordPanID (ID)
CoordAddrMode
0x02 = 16-bit Short Address
0x03 = 64-bit Long Address
Channel (CH parameter)
SecurityUse
ACLEntry
SecurityFailure
SuperFrameSpec (2 bytes):
bit 15 - Association Permitted (MSB)
bit 14 - PAN Coordinator
bit 13 - Reserved
bit 12 - Battery Life Extension
bits 8-11 - Final CAP Slot
bits 4-7 - Superframe Order
bits 0-3 - Beacon Order
GtsPermit
RSSI (RSSI is returned as -dBm)
TimeStamp (3 bytes)
<CR>
A carriage return is sent at the end of the AS command. The Active Scan is
capable of returning up to 5 PanDescriptors in a scan. The actual scan time on each
channel is measured as Time = [(2 ^SD PARAM) * 15.36] ms. Note the total scan time is
this time multiplied by the number of channels to be scanned (16 for the XBee and 13
for the XBee-PRO). Also refer to SD command description.
0 - 6
-
ED ( v1.x80*)
Networking
{Association}
Energy Scan. Send an Energy Detect Scan. This parameter determines the length of
scan on each channel. The maximal energy on each channel is returned & each value
is followed by a carriage return. An additional carriage return is sent at the end of the
command. The values returned represent the detected energy level in units of -dBm.
The actual scan time on each channel is measured as Time = [(2 ^ED) * 15.36] ms.
Note the total scan time is this time multiplied by the number of channels to be scanned
(refer to SD parameter).
0 - 6
-
EE ( v1.xA0*)
Networking
{Security}
AES Encryption Enable. Disable/Enable 128-bit AES encryption support. Use in
conjunction with the KY command.
0 - 1
0 (disabled)
KY ( v1.xA0*)
Networking
{Security}
AES Encryption Key. Set the 128-bit AES (Advanced Encryption Standard) key for
encrypting/decrypting data. The KY register cannot be read.
0 - (any 16-Byte value)
-
Table?03.   XBee/XBeePRO燙ommands?燫F營(yíng)nterfacing
AT
Command
Command
Category
Name and Description
Parameter Range
Default
PL
RF Interfacing
Power Level. Select/Read the power level at which the RF module transmits conducted
power.
NOTE: XBee-PRO RF Modules optimized for use in Japan contain firmware that limits
transmit power output to 10 dBm. If PL=4 (default), the maximum power output level is
fixed at 10 dBm.
0 - 4 (XBee / XBee-PRO)
0 =  -10 / 10 dBm
1 =  -6 / 12 dBm
2 =  -4 / 14 dBm
3 =   -2 / 16 dBm
4 =  0 / 18 dBm
4
CA (v1.x80*)
RF Interfacing
CCA Threshold. Set/read the CCA (Clear Channel Assessment) threshold. Prior to
transmitting a packet, a CCA is performed to detect energy on the channel. If the
detected energy is above the CCA Threshold, the module will not transmit the packet.
0 - 0x50 [-dBm]
0x2C
(-44d dBm)
Table?02.   XBee/XBeePRO燙ommands?燦etworking?燬ecurity?/SPAN>(Subcategories?/SPAN>designated?/SPAN>within?/SPAN>{brackets})
AT
Command
Command
Category
Name and Description
Parameter Range
Default